As a Security Officer, you'll play a critical role in keeping patients, visitors, staff, and UPMC facilities safe and secure-while working a 12-hour shift from 6:00 a.m. to 6:00 p.m. that allows you to work just 7 days in a 14‑day pay period. That means 7 days off every two weeks, giving you extended time to recharge, focus on family, or pursue personal interests. In this role, you'll maintain a visible security presence, respond to situations with professionalism and care, and deliver excellent customer service-all while being part of a team dedicated to safety, service, and community. Physical & Fitness Requirements + Must meet physical fitness standards necessary for the role, including full body movement, strength, and stamina sufficient to: + Respond to crisis interventions + Assist with medical emergencies + Perform continuous standing, walking, and other physical demands + Must successfully pass the UPMC Physical Fitness Standard prior to hire. + Must meet established audio (hearing) and visual standards. Licensure, Certifications & Clearances + New York State Security Guard License (Unarmed) required under Article 7A of the General Business Law. + Federal Bureau of Investigation (FBI) Criminal History Record Clearance required every 60 months. + Valid Driver's License required. + Basic Life Support (BLS) or Cardiopulmonary Resuscitation (CPR) certification required. + Comprehensive Crisis Management Certification (CCMC) required. + Successful completion of a required personality assessment prior to hire.
